GENERIC revision 1.325 1 # $NetBSD: GENERIC,v 1.325 2008/08/10 15:31:20 tls Exp $
2 #
3 # This machine description file is used to generate the default NetBSD
4 # kernel.
5 #
6 # The machine description file can be customised for your specific
7 # machine to reduce the kernel size and improve its performance.
8 #
9 # For further information on compiling NetBSD kernels, see the config(8)
10 # man page.
11 #
12 # For further information on hardware support for this architecture, see
13 # the intro(4) man page. For further information about kernel options
14 # for this architecture, see the options(4) man page. For an explanation
15 # of each device driver in this file see the section 4 man page for the
16 # device.

26 # CPU Support
27 options DEC_2000_300 # "Jensen": 2000/300 (DECpc AXP 150)
28 options DEC_2100_A50 # Avanti etc: AlphaStation 400, 200, etc.
29 options DEC_2100_A500 # Sable: AlphaServer 2100
30 options DEC_2100A_A500 # Lynx: AlphaServer 2100A
31 options DEC_3000_500 # Flamingo etc: 3000/[4-9]00*
32 options DEC_3000_300 # Pelican etc: 3000/300*
33 options DEC_AXPPCI_33 # NoName: AXPpci33, Multia, etc.
34 options DEC_EB164 # EB164: AlphaPC 164
35 options DEC_EB64PLUS # EB64+: AlphaPC 64, etc.
36 options DEC_KN20AA # KN20AA: AlphaStation 500 and 600
37 options DEC_KN8AE # KN8AE: AlphaServer 8200 and 8400
38 options DEC_KN300 # KN300: AlphaServer 4100 and 1200
39 options DEC_550 # Miata: Digital Personal Workstation
40 options DEC_1000 # Mikasa etc: Digital AlphaServer 1000
41 options DEC_1000A # Corelle etc: Digital AlphaServer 800/1000A
42 options DEC_ALPHABOOK1 # AlphaBook1: Tadpole/DEC AlphaBook
43 options DEC_EB66 # EB66: 21066 Evaluation Board
44 options DEC_6600 # EV6: 264DP OEM Board
45 options API_UP1000 # EV6: Alpha Processor, Inc. UP1000

70 # File systems
71 file-system FFS # Fast file system
72 file-system MFS # Memory-based file system
73 file-system LFS # Log-structured file system
74 file-system CD9660 # ISO-9660 CD-ROM FS (w/RockRidge extensions)
75 file-system ADOSFS # AmigaDOS-compatible file system
76 file-system MSDOSFS # MS-DOS-compatible file system
77 file-system NTFS # Windows/NT file system (experimental)
78 file-system EXT2FS # Linux ext2 file system
79 file-system NFS # Sun NFS-compatible file system client
80 file-system NULLFS # Null file system layer
81 file-system KERNFS # Kernel variable file system (/kern)
82 file-system FDESC # File descriptor file system (/dev/fd)
83 file-system PORTAL # Portal file system
84 file-system UMAPFS # User-mapping file system layer
85 file-system PROCFS # Process file system (/proc)
86 file-system UNION # union file system
87 file-system CODA # CODA distributed file system
88 file-system SMBFS # experimental - CIFS; also needs nsmb (below)
89 file-system PTYFS # /dev/pts/N support
90 #file-system TMPFS # Efficient memory file-system
91 #file-system UDF # experimental - OSTA UDF CD/DVD file-system
